Nine Masts Capital's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2017, Nine Masts Capital held 283 positions worth $675M, down 20% from $840M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 83% of the portfolio.

Nine Masts Capital withdrew a net $377M in Q3 2017, closing 112 positions and reducing 27 holdings. Its most notable exit was TSMC, an estimated $63.2M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Communication Services at 30% of assets, up from 13%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Financials.

Against the trend, Nine Masts Capital opened a new position in Vale S A worth $7.98M.
